Job Summary

The Facilities Maintenance Technician is a critical role at Casella Waste Systems, responsible for installing, maintaining, troubleshooting, and repairing machinery and equipment. This position requires a strong understanding of mechanical, electrical, and hydraulic systems, as well as excellent problem-solving and communication skills.

Key Responsibilities
  • Read and interpret equipment manuals to perform required maintenance and service.
  • Prevent plant breakdowns by performing planned preventive maintenance on conveying systems, power transmissions, and other power-driven rotating equipment.
  • Communicate equipment issues resolution to operators and work in extreme environments that are often dirty.
  • Repair or coordinate repair of worn or defective machinery or equipment, test machines to ensure quality and rate of production meets specifications.
  • Perform extensive housekeeping duties and use a variety of small tools, hand-powered tools, and knives while complying with safety regulations.
Requirements
  • High school diploma or GED.
  • Progressive technician training.
  • 1-5 years experience diagnosing and repairing equipment.
  • Demonstrated ability to work as part of a team in a collaborative environment.
  • Legally eligible to work in the US.
